The small-block Chevrolet engine has proven to be one of the least reliable engines in 24 Hours of LeMons racing, but there's one that's even worse: the Nissan L28. Some teams see that as a challenge!
The Junk Yard Kats 280ZX Turbo, veteran of several California LeMons races, was looking pretty good at the Sears Pointless LeMons race back in March...

...right up until the Kats got involved in an apocalyptic wreck, completely destroying their Nissan.
But the L28ET engine survived, and the Kats got to thinking: maybe we should drop the engine in a different kind of car. How about a third-gen GM F-body? Good idea! We're hoping it beats the odds and runs away with the race.
